A week ago we were the Brady bunch. Shawn had 4 boys when we met 1 of which he was raising alone. I had 2 boys and a girl I was raising alone. He was my knight in shining armor protecting me and my kids and loving me more than any woman could ask for. His health had steadily been declining and as he felt worse we bickered over what I thought was him being a sissy over his "head aches". Tuesday when he collapsed in my kitchen and I took him to the ER we assumed it was related to his diabetes or hypertension. We had no idea headed to the ER that our lives were about to be forever changed. First the cat scan checking for a concussion showed a "suspect" mass, he was admitted the next day MRI which revealed a glioma (cancer tumor of the brain) Wednesday night he was taken by ambulance transfer to LSU Shreveport. More MRI's confirmed first diagnosis. We could tell it was bad when the first hospital staff started giving us those looks, the ones that say you poor people with their eyes. Thursday 9-11 the neurosurgeon came in to discuss Friday surgery we just kept thinking 4 days ago we were a normal family. I was tasked with telling our children Friday night that Shawn was going to have a surgery on his brain. When he is released the daily trips 4 hours round trip begin for radiation for the next several weeks. See the tumor had fused deep in his brain meaning only 60% could be removed with surgery. This tumor. Will continue to grow back but at this time it is low grade meaning slow growth rate. I am the only one working a new job as we just moved a year ago and have no family near. Gas this week alone has cost $350 and I don't know how we are going to afford these bills. Shawn is so loving right before surgery his only concern was if I was gonna be ok.
